A safe-by-default command-line tool for managing Microsoft Copilot Studio copilots, sub-agents, and conversation analytics. Pure Bash with no SDK dependencies — just curl, jq, and your Azure AD credentials.
Copilot Studio is powerful, but the portal is a ceiling. You can't script it, you can't diff agents, you can't export a conversation and actually see what happened inside a multi-phase research run. I needed programmatic access to everything — agents, conversations, the raw execution data — with safety guardrails I could trust against production.
So I built it. Pure curl + jq, no SDKs, no dependencies I don't control.

Agents in Copilot Studio are just structured config — YAML, JSON, topics, actions. AI assistants are great at exactly that. The CLI is the bridge between "Claude editing a file" and "that file becoming a live agent."
But here's the thing most people miss: the agents themselves aren't the gold — the data they produce is.
Every conversation export contains raw_activities.json — a complete behavioral trace of everything the agent did. Every search query it ran, every citation it found, every tool it called, every decision it made, with full timing data. That's not a chat log. That's structured intelligence you can mine, analyze across runs, and feed back into better agents.
The portal shows you a chat bubble. This CLI gives you the full execution trace. Get your shovels.

The export pipeline automatically detects multi-agent orchestration phases from "Starting phase X of Y:" messages in bot output and generates per-phase analytics:
- Phase boundary detection with time-window segmentation
- Per-phase metrics: activity counts, tool usage breakdown, search counts, duration
- Web search extraction from
GenerativeAnswersSupportDataevents with full citations - Research findings and AI observations grouped by phase
Each export generates a Chart.js dashboard (dashboard.html) with:
- All Searches tab — sortable/filterable table with expandable citations, phase color-coding
- Messages tab — conversation timeline with expandable content
- Phase Findings tab — research findings organized by phase
- Tool usage distribution chart, phase duration comparison, search activity by phase

- Tenant safety — active tenant must match profile tenant for any write operation
- Protected profiles — profiles marked
"protected": true(or named*prod*) require--i-know-this-is-prodfor writes - Mandatory confirmation — destructive operations require both
--yes-really-deleteand--confirm <exact-name> - Auto-backup before delete — copilot and agent deletes automatically back up first; delete fails closed if backup fails
- JSONL audit log — every mutating operation logged to
logs/audit/operations.jsonlwith timestamp, actor, tenant, command, exit code, and backup path - Dry-run mode —
--dry-runprints the translated command without executing

pistudio transcripts export --bot-guid <bot-guid> -p prodAll write operations enforce these guardrails:
| Guard | What It Does |
|---|---|
--profile required |
Writes require a profile so tenant safety can be enforced |
| Tenant check | Active Azure AD tenant must match the profile's tenantId |
| Protected profiles | Profiles named *prod* or with "protected": true block writes unless --i-know-this-is-prod is passed |
--yes-really-delete |
Required for any delete operation |
--confirm <name> |
Must repeat the exact copilot/agent name or ID |
| Auto-backup | Backups run before every delete; delete fails closed if backup fails |
| Audit log | All mutations logged to logs/audit/operations.jsonl |
| Dry-run | --dry-run on any command prints the translated flags without executing |

bin/pistudio CLI wrapper — translates subcommands to --flag syntax
|
+-- scripts/auth.sh Shared auth module (PKCE, device code, token refresh)
|
+-- scripts/export-activities.sh Core engine (~5700 lines)
|
+-- Power Platform BAP API Environment discovery
+-- Dataverse API Bot/agent CRUD, transcripts
+-- DirectLine API Conversation history
+-- jq Analytics pipeline + report generation
No external SDKs. Authentication uses the Azure CLI public client app ID (04b07795-8ddb-461a-bbee-02f9e1bf7b46) with standard OAuth2 flows. Tokens are stored in ~/.config/pistudio/tokens/ (chmod 0600) with per-process session caching.
